Motapara Population - Banswara, Rajasthan

Motapara is a medium size village located in Kushalgarh Tehsil of Banswara district, Rajasthan with total 283 families residing. The Motapara village has population of 1505 of which 764 are males while 741 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Motapara village population of children with age 0-6 is 328 which makes up 21.79 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Motapara village is 970 which is higher than Rajasthan state average of 928. Child Sex Ratio for the Motapara as per census is 988, higher than Rajasthan average of 888.

Motapara village has lower literacy rate compared to Rajasthan. In 2011, literacy rate of Motapara village was 48.60 % compared to 66.11 % of Rajasthan. In Motapara Male literacy stands at 64.77 % while female literacy rate was 31.83 %.

Caste Factor

In Motapara village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 91.50 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 7.38 % of total population in Motapara village.

Work Profile

In Motapara village out of total population, 801 were engaged in work activities. 80.52 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 19.48 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 801 workers engaged in Main Work, 493 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 109 were Agricultural labourer.
